- 博客(8)
- 收藏
- 关注
原创 jQuery 封装 ajax 的使用方法
jQuery中 封装的 ajax请求 有3种1, $.get() get请求方式参数有4个参数,必填参数是 url地址 其他参数都是选填参数,可以没有参数的形式是对象形式$.get({url : 地址(必填)data : 携带的参数 对象形式dataType : 期望的数据类型,如果为json,会将后端返回的json串,自动解析success : function(){} 请求...
2020-05-05 12:15:15 140
原创 面向对象编程思想
所谓的面向对象,是一种编程思想,编程思路,代码的书写格式,复杂程序的封装,封装成其他形式,使用面向对象的方式来封装程序。面向对象 :有封装好的面向对象的的程序直接调用执行就可以了功能和作用类似于 封装好的函数但是 封装的语法和思想与函数不同面向对象的基本思想基本思路就是,创建一个对象,给这个对象,添加上属性和属性值,还有函数等方法之后通过操作这个对象,来完成需要的效果// 先通过...
2020-04-18 14:23:32 107
原创 循环遍历 for循环,for...in循环,forEach循环的区别
循环遍历的方法有3种,for循环,for…in循环,forEach循环。一.for循环通过for循环,生成所有的索引下标for(var i = 0 ; i <= arr.length-1 ; i++){ 程序内容 }二.for…in循环for(var key in arr){程序}arr 代表的循环遍历的对象或者数组key 代表的循环遍历的 对象中的属性名 或者 数组的索引...
2020-04-06 16:15:46 201
原创 利用 indexOf() 的数组去重
利用 indexOf() 的数组去重var a = [1,2,1,'北京',2,2,3,'北京',4,5,4,6,7,7,8,1];console.log(a);var b = []; // 建立一个空的新数组a.forEach(function(val){ // 利用 数组.forEach 获取 数组a 中的 数据 if (b.indexOf(val) == -1){// 判断 数据...
2020-03-21 17:00:34 216
原创 JS冒泡排序和选择排序
JS冒泡排序和选择排序一.冒泡排序通过for循环,实现排序,每次循环,找到一个当前的最大值,多次循环,完成排序。以下为冒泡排序的运行原理:现在我们先定义一个数组 var a = [5,7,4,2,3,1,8,6,9,10];var a = [5,7,4,2,3,1,8,6,9,10];;console.log(a);让数组继续一次以下循环for (var i = 0; i &l...
2020-03-21 16:50:02 136
原创 数据类型的转化
数据类型的转化在 JavaScript 程序中 , 变量中存储的数据类型没有限制,也就是在变量中可以存储任何符合JavaScript语法规范的数据类型,但是 在 JavaScript 程序的执行过程中,往往需要变量中存储的数值是某种特定的数据类型,别的数据类型不行,此时就需要进行数据类型的转化。所谓的数据类型转化,就是将当前数据类型转化为其他数据类型,JavaScript中数据类型的转化,分为...
2020-03-14 18:06:36 186
原创 display:flex属性
display:flex属性以下都是我在逆战班学习的知识哦display:flex 属性是添加到父容器上的,让父容器具备弹性,如何让子元素在父元素中上下左右居中也可以为父元素加display:flex属性然后为子元素加margin:auto<!DOCTYPE html><html> <head> <meta charset="utf-8"&g...
2020-03-01 16:47:20 649
原创 css清除浮动
css清除浮动上下排列的情况现在有两个div,box1 box2 它们上下排版<!DOCTYPE html><html> <head> <meta charset="utf-8" /> <title></title> </head> <style> .box1{ widt...
2020-02-22 23:36:42 126
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人